Ketch Harbour is both a rural fishing and residential community located on the Chebucto Peninsula 17 kilometers from Halifax.  This community has been a fishing spot for over two hundred years. The area was one of the earliest settlements following colonization of Halifax in 1749. Residences are a mix of old world charm and modern architecture.

Area attractions include Duncans Cove Nature Reserve, York Redoubt National Historic Site,  and the Chebucto Head Lighthouse.
